Output 34f7891c98f8a167b9303ee66553c83e0879a534d5c18b1e3201416949aa5843:3

value
712989589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c3045055bce889a629e74d4e0af2909686eb883 OP_EQUALVERIFY OP_CHECKSIG
address
Fc7ZdKYhcriCDA8CtEFXLyhLRPatQFDEYn
transaction
34f7891c98f8a167b9303ee66553c83e0879a534d5c18b1e3201416949aa5843